As long as you take them off the right way, no.
I used to worry about this, too, but press-ons are gentler than gels oracrylics.
You should lightly buff the natural nail to remove the shine and wipe with alcohol.
Instead, soak them in warm, soapy water or use anail polish remover.
If you do that, your natural nails won’t suffer.
There are also many adhesive options now that are easier on your nails.
On the other hand, adhesive tabs are convenient and easy to apply.
There is also a middle categorypre-glued nailsbut these are typically best for shorter wear times as well.
Both types are easy to remove, with tabs coming off the easiest, says Ornellas.
For tabs, just apply cuticle oil and gently rock the nail from side to side.
For glued press-ons, soak in warm, soapy water and wiggle gently.
If glue residue remains, lightly buff it off.
If needed, soak in acetone, though this may prevent reuse."
